About this puzzle

The NYT Spelling Bee for Friday, September 17, 2021 uses the seven letters A, C, G, I, N, R, Y, with Y as the center letter that must appear in every word.

Today's puzzle has 33 accepted words for a total of 171 points. To reach Genius rank, players need 119 points — about 70% of the total. The full Queen Bee score requires every word.

This puzzle has 2 pangrams — words that use all seven letters. Each pangram earns a 7-point bonus on top of its regular score.
